In episode #1127, we share 7 marketing tools for the second half of 2019. Tune in to hear what tools you should be using.
TIME-STAMPED SHOW NOTES:
- [00:25] Today’s Topic: Seven Marketing Tools for the Second Half of 2019
- [00:30] Number 1: Rafflepress is a new WordPress plugin that allows you to run contests.
- [00:54] Number 2: Google Data Studio allows you to create custom reports and dashboards from your existing Google data sources.
- [01:28] Number 3: Pattern89 does artificial intelligence for Facebook ads and YouTube to help you optimize your advertising.
- [01:46] Companies see an average of a 21% performance improvement on their Facebook ads using Pattern89.
- [01:53] Number 4: Jetson AI allows you to sell your products or services through voice search on home consoles like Google Home and Amazon Alexa.
- [02:51] Number 5: Hull.io is a customer data platform that uses the data you already have to generate leads for your business and build outreach strategies around them.
- [03:41] Eric recommends that only businesses with at least five figures of monthly website traffic consider using this tool because they will benefit most from it.
- [03:56] Number 6: Price Intelligently Calculator from ProfitWell is a tool to help you calculate the best pricing strategy for your business to help you make the maximum amount of money.
- [04:25] Their price optimization typically leads to a 15% increase in new revenue.
- [04:49] Number 7 is Intercom, an all-in-one customer engagement tool that lets you chat with them directly, create email campaigns, show them specifically tailored content, and more.
